How can I know that the flips on my 3D Lenticular prints will look fine?

Answer

There is no way to get an exact on-screen preview of how the final lenticular flip will print, since the effect only fully comes to life on the physical lens. That said, following a few guidelines gives you the best possible result.

  • Use frames with strong, clear differences so each flip reads distinctly
  • Keep the number of transition frames modest so each stays crisp
  • Avoid tiny text or fine detail in the areas that change during the flip
  • Build files at 300 DPI so the interlaced image stays sharp
